Definitions:

Mental Imagery

The mind's ability to recreate or simulate sensory experiences in the absence of immediate external stimuli, involving visual, auditory, or other sensory modalities.

Implicit Memory

A type of long-term memory that operates below the conscious level, enabling the performance of tasks without conscious awareness of these previous experiences.

Conscious Awareness

Conscious Awareness is the mental state of being fully alert, aware, and attentive to one's thoughts, feelings, and surroundings.

Introspection

The examination of one's own thoughts and feelings, a method often used in psychology.
